Guild is hiring for an Associate Manager on our Student Operations Support team.
More about the role:
The Associate Manager will lead and support the daily operations of a team of Student Operations Specialists, who are responsible for helping students to maintain momentum and overcome barriers in the enrollment process of their chosen academic provider.
In particular, we are looking for a leader who can work up, down, and across an organization, ask the hard questions, and who is excited to help drive growth and successful student outcomes at Guild. As an Associate Manager of Student Operations, you are responsible for contributing to the leadership, management, and operational oversight of Guild’s rapidly growing Student Operations team.

Guild is increasing economic mobility for working adults by partnering with the largest employers in the country to offer education as a benefit to their employees via our marketplace of nonprofit universities and education institutions. Guild’s proprietary technology platform facilitates the administration of this innovative benefit and our team of coaches helps each employee navigate the path back to school, providing individualized support from day one through program completion.
Guild is a female-led, Certified B Corporation - and with a valuation of $3.8 billion is one of the highest-valued, privately held education companies in the world, and the only one led by a woman. Guild's investors include Ken Chenault, General Catalyst Partners, chairman and former CEO of American Express, Emerson, and Iconiq.
